About Ramchandrapur Village

Ramchandrapur is a mid sized village in Debra tehsil, in the district of Paschim Medinipur, West Bengal.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,399, made up of 701 males and 698 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 996 females per 1000 males. The village covers 116.65 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 721156,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Ramchandrapur

The census records public bus service for Ramchandrapur as Available within 10+ km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
